How can I stand out as an applicant?
Align your resume with LabCorp’s mission by highlighting projects that improved data throughput or reduced test turnaround. Showcase experience with healthcare data standards (HL7, LOINC), cloud platforms (AWS, Azure), and security compliance (HIPAA). Include open‑source contributions or publications related to diagnostics or AI. Finally, prepare a concise portfolio or code sample that demonstrates problem‑solving in a real‑world clinical context.
